Ingredients:
1/2 cup (firmly packed) brown sugar
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 1/4 cups self-raising flour
3/4 cup plain flour
1/2 cup coconut
raspberry (or fav. flavoured) jam
Filling:
60g butter
3/4 cup icing sugar
1/2 teaspoon vanilla
2 teaspoons milk
Method:
Preheat oven to 180c
Cream butter and sugar, add egg and vanilla, mix well.
Add sifted dry ingredients and coconut, mix well.
Roll teaspoonfuls of mixture into balls and place on lightly greased tray. Press down, and rough up surface a little with the back of a fork.
Bake 10-15 mins. until golden brown.
Cool on cake rack.
Place a teaspoon of jam, and a teaspoon of the filling mixture in centre of half the biscuits. Top with the remaining half and press together.
Filling method:
Cream butter and sifted icing sugar, add vanilla, gradually add milk and beat well.
Makes approx. 25 complete biscuits.
3. Choc Chip Montes
Use the same recipe as above – omitting the filling and jam.
Add a cup of choc chips after sifting dry ingredients and leave as single biscuits. Great for kids lunch boxes!! :)
